    What Is an Argumentative Essay? Definition, Structure, and Examples

    An argumentative essay is a type of writing in which the writer presents a clear opinion on a topic and supports it with facts, reasons, and examples. The main goal of an argumentative essay is to convince the reader by using logical thinking and strong evidence, not emotions. In this guide, you will learn what an argumentative essay is, its purpose, and how it is different from other types of essays. This lesson is helpful for students, exam preparation, and ESL learners who want to improve their academic writing and critical thinking skills. Why is an Argumentative Essay Important? Argumentative essays help you develop critical thinking and persuasive skills. They teach you how to: Analyze different perspectives. Support your ideas with evidence. Communicate your thoughts…
